Luxury Watch Market: Why Heritage Brands Still Dominate the Global Collector Economy

The luxury watch industry has always sold more than timekeeping — it sells scarcity, heritage, and proof of status. That formula continues to hold up commercially: the global luxury watch market was valued at USD 16.9 billion in 2025 and is projected to grow from USD 17.6 billion in 2026 to USD 24.5 billion by 2033, at a CAGR of 4.8%. That's a slower, steadier growth curve than most consumer categories, and understanding why reveals a lot about how this market actually functions. Market Structure: Why Luxury Watches Don't Grow Like Other Luxury Goods Unlike fashion or beauty, where trend cycles drive rapid turnover, the luxury watch market is structurally built around controlled scarcity. Brands deliberately under-produce flagship references relative to demand, which sustains resale premiums and, in turn, reinforces the perception of watches as appreciating assets rather than depreciating purchases.
